Missed You the Most

Sitting here stuck in front of this TV screen

People popping up that for 20 years I haven't seen

Some can put a very big smile on this old face

Other I shed a tear wishing they were still in my space

To just some I send a note or two

Just to see what they may want to do

The few responses bring me back to life

To when we lived on the edge of a very thin knife

It was all about friends and having fun

I think we were still friends after it was all done

Some of those times we lived only by moving fast

Yet sat down and laughed after it all went past

Threw out the years I've only missed a few

But darling please believe at the top was only you

Thank God that we now have the world wide web

I now remember when on my shoulder you laid your head

Also the sweet smell of your every different perfume

And the smile I had every time you entered the room

Now I just sit back , smiling, wonder and dwell

Had I hung around could we have done very well

Those are the questions that are close  to the heart

But in our life's the answer will never be a part

So as the questions and emotions start running threw

One of the people I've missed most was surely you!
